Hey Everyone,

I've been at my job (hogwan) only two months, but I know I will be asked to renew in the next 2-3 months and I'm curious as to how I should handle myself.

I was asked to renew within the first two weeks of teaching. I politely declined and said that I would definitely consider re-signing at a later date if everything went well in the school. They understood and said they would give me time to think about it.

Within these first two months I have made a name for myself in the school. My students enjoy having me as a teacher, the staff seems to enjoy having me at the school (I am the only male teacher) and students that I don't teach at all also come running when they see me. I feel like I've started to build something here that I can be proud of.

With that said, I know other teachers, when asked to renew their contracts, asked for a raise and received one. I'm not sure how much the raise was.

I've also volunteered my photography skills, incorporated music (I perform) into the classroom, and have been asked by parents to have me as the teacher for their child.

What should I ask for when the time comes?

Tell them that you'll consider renewing the contract 2 months before your current contract expires. If you had wanted a 24 month contract you could have signed one from the get go.

You have to wait and see what the average job offer is in 8 months from now. Then add 100,000 Won to it. That's probably about the only bonus that you'll get for renewing a contract. You might negotiate and extra few days vacation.

But in any case, hold off on renewing until you're almost finished. You might decide by then that you'd like to work elsewhere (another city, another country, or many even just another school).
